Elementary Statistics" is a textbook written by author Mario Triola, which aims to provide an introduction to statistics for students who have little or no prior knowledge of the subject. The 13th edition of this textbook was published in 2018.
The book covers a wide range of statistical topics, including descriptive statistics, probability, hypothesis testing, correlation, regression analysis, and nonparametric methods. It also provides examples and exercises that are designed to help students develop their statistical skills and understanding.
The textbook is organized into 13 chapters, which progress logically from basic concepts to more advanced topics. Each chapter includes numerous examples, illustrations, and exercises to help students practice and apply the concepts covered in the chapter. Additionally, the book includes real-life applications of statistical techniques in a variety of fields, such as business, social sciences, and health care.
Overall, "Elementary Statistics" 13th edition is a comprehensive textbook that provides a solid foundation in statistical concepts and techniques for students who are new to the subject.
